Установлено 14.04 на не-PAE (Pentium-M), но теперь я не могу обновить ("Это ядро ​​не поддерживает CPU не-PAE".)

Вот что я смотрю Это не мой компьютер. Я ремонтирую ПК, и у меня был конечный пользователь с этим маломощным ноутбуком под управлением XP, поэтому я решил позволить ему попробовать lubuntu. Установка прошла без проблем с переключателем загрузки без PAE, но теперь я не могу ничего обновить. Я бы предпочел не форматировать и начинать все сначала, так как он потратил время на настройку своей системы. Любые советы будут оценены. Я пробовал sudo apt-get clean, sudo apt-get install -f, sudo apt-get update. Нет идти

Также перестал работать его тачпад, перестала работать беспроводная связь, клавиатура работает в Firefox, но не в Chrome, а в Firefox адресная строка иногда почему-то становится черной и серой. Я надеялся, что обновление поможет решить некоторые из этих проблем.

Вот сообщение, которое я пытаюсь обновить:

Get:1 http://us.archive.ubuntu.com/ubuntu/ trusty-proposed/main linux-image-3.13.0-26-generic i386 3.13.0-26.48 [14.6 MB]
Get:2 http://us.archive.ubuntu.com/ubuntu/ trusty-updates/main linux-image-3.13.0-24-generic i386 3.13.0-24.47 [14.6 MB]
Fetched 29.2 MB in 2min 19s (208 kB/s)                                         
(Reading database ... 169286 files and directories currently installed.)
Preparing to unpack .../linux-image-3.13.0-26-generic_3.13.0-26.48_i386.deb ...
This kernel does not support a non-PAE CPU.
dpkg: error processing archive /var/cache/apt/archives/linux-image-3.13.0-26-generic_3.13.0-26.48_i386.deb (--unpack):
 subprocess new pre-installation script returned error exit status 1
Examining /etc/kernel/postrm.d .
run-parts: executing /etc/kernel/postrm.d/initramfs-tools 3.13.0-26-generic /boot/vmlinuz-3.13.0-26-generic
run-parts: executing /etc/kernel/postrm.d/zz-update-grub 3.13.0-26-generic /boot/vmlinuz-3.13.0-26-generic
Preparing to unpack .../linux-image-3.13.0-24-generic_3.13.0-24.47_i386.deb ...
This kernel does not support a non-PAE CPU.
dpkg: error processing archive /var/cache/apt/archives/linux-image-3.13.0-24-generic_3.13.0-24.47_i386.deb (--unpack):
 subprocess new pre-installation script returned error exit status 1
Examining /etc/kernel/postrm.d .
run-parts: executing /etc/kernel/postrm.d/initramfs-tools 3.13.0-24-generic /boot/vmlinuz-3.13.0-24-generic
run-parts: executing /etc/kernel/postrm.d/zz-update-grub 3.13.0-24-generic /boot/vmlinuz-3.13.0-24-generic
Errors were encountered while processing:
 /var/cache/apt/archives/linux-image-3.13.0-26-generic_3.13.0-26.48_i386.deb
 /var/cache/apt/archives/linux-image-3.13.0-24-generic_3.13.0-24.47_i386.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)

2 ответа

Решение

При установке на систему без поддержки pae, используя forcepae опция, которую вы все еще можете загрузить без этой опции, установленной в Grub. Последующие обновления ядра не будут выполнены.

Чтобы преодолеть это, добавьте следующую строку в ваш /etc/default/grub (источник: комментарий № 4 к ошибке № 1307105):

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ash forcepae"

Тогда беги

sudo update-grub

и перезагрузите систему, чтобы изменения вступили в силу.

Установка версии i386 для fake-pae может помочь, и позволит обновить систему. У меня была похожая проблема на моем Dell Latitude D600. Единственный способ, который я нашел, - это установить жесткий диск Dell на новую машину, установить на него Ubuntu 14.04, вернуть жесткий диск в Dell, а затем установить fake-pae i386. После этого все работало нормально.

Другие вопросы по тегам